Kenai Peninsula Borough School District The Kenai Peninsula Borough provides the major funding for the Peninsula’s public schools. KPBSD serves 44 sites in 21 diverse communities, and the district’s total student population is 11% Alaska Native. The district covers 25,600 square miles, which is larger than the entire state of West Virginia.

In 2023, Seward, AK had a population of 2.74k people with a median age of 42.6 and a median household income of $71,016. Between 2022 and 2023 the population of Seward, AK declined from 2,768 to 2,735, a −1.19% decrease and its median household income declined from $77,850 to $71,016, a −8.78% decrease.

The Census Bureau considers an incorporated city with a population greater than 2,500 to be urban, of which there are four in the KPB: Homer, Kenai, Seward and Soldotna. As of Census 2000 Kenai is ranked 6th largest in Alaska, Homer ranks 14th, and Soldotna is the 15th largest Alaskan city. Oil and gas jobs, tourism and retirees T he Kenai Peninsula Borough is home to 8 percent of Alaska’s population and 6 percent of its employment. The borough’s economic activity revolves around government, oil and gas production and refi ning, the visitor industry and fi shing. List of all cities and towns in Kenai Peninsula Borough Kenai Peninsula Borough is a borough in Alaska, United States. The population was 58,799 as of the 2020 census, up from 55,400 in 2010. The borough seat is Soldotna, the largest city is Kenai, and the most populous community is Kalifornsky, a census-designated place. Hope is a census-designated place revolves around (CDP) in Kenai Peninsula Borough in the U.S. state of Alaska. It is 70 miles south from Anchorage. As of the 2010 census the population was 192, [2] up from 137 in 2000. The Hope Historic District, which includes the surviving elements of the former mining town, was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1972. [3]

It is located on Resurrection Bay, which is a type of narrow ocean inlet called a fjord. Seward sits on Alaska’s southern coast, about 120 miles (193 km) by road from Anchorage, Alaska’s largest city.
Bear Creek is a census-designated place (CDP) in Kenai Peninsula Borough, Alaska, United States. At the 2020 census the population was 2,129 up from 1,956 in 2010. Bear Creek is a few miles north of Seward near the stream of the same name and its source, Bear Lake.
